117.info
人生若只如初见

Oracle备份的几种方式

Oracle备份有以下几种方式:

  1. 数据库冷备份(Cold Backup):在数据库关闭的状态下,直接备份数据库的数据文件、控制文件和归档日志文件。

  2. 数据库热备份(Hot Backup):在数据库运行的状态下,通过使用Oracle的在线备份功能,备份数据文件、控制文件和归档日志文件。

  3. 数据库增量备份(Incremental Backup):只备份自上次备份以来发生变化的数据块和日志文件,以减少备份时间和存储空间的占用。

  4. 数据库逻辑备份(Logical Backup):使用Oracle的导出(expdp)和导入(impdp)工具,将数据库的逻辑结构和数据导出到一个可读的文件中,然后再进行恢复。

  5. 数据库镜像备份(Mirrored Backup):使用Oracle的数据镜像功能,在多个物理磁盘上同时存储数据库的副本,以提高备份的可用性和容错性。

  6. 数据库点备份(Point-in-Time Recovery):通过使用归档日志文件,将数据库恢复到指定的时间点,以实现部分恢复或故障恢复。

以上是常见的Oracle备份方式,具体选择哪种方式取决于备份的需求和数据库的特点。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e3baAzsLAAJSBl0.html

推荐文章

  • oracle怎么查看当前用户的表空间

    要查看Oracle数据库中当前用户的表空间,可以执行以下步骤:1. 首先,使用`SELECT USER FROM DUAL;`查询当前用户的用户名。2. 然后,使用以下语句查询当前用户的...

  • oracle怎么查看某个表的表分区

    要查看某个表的表分区,可以使用以下步骤:1. 首先,登录到Oracle数据库。2. 使用以下命令切换到表所在的模式:ALTER SESSION SET CURRENT_SCHEMA = schema_name...

  • oracle怎么查看表空间剩余大小

    您可以使用以下命令来查看Oracle数据库中表空间的剩余大小:1. 首先,以sysdba身份登录到Oracle数据库:sqlplus / as sysdba2. 运行以下查询语句来查看表空间的剩...

  • oracle怎么查看用户表空间大小

    要查看Oracle数据库中用户表空间的大小,可以使用以下SQL语句:SELECT tablespace_name, SUM(bytes)/1024/1024 AS "Size (MB)"
    FROM dba_data_files
    G...

  • Matlab中tic和toc用法

    在MATLAB中,tic和toc是一对用来计算程序运行时间的函数。
    tic函数用于启动一个计时器,而toc函数用于停止计时器并返回经过的时间。
    下面是tic和toc的...

  • Windows更改启动引导项

    要更改Windows的启动引导项,可以按照以下步骤操作: 打开命令提示符或PowerShell窗口(以管理员身份运行)。 输入命令“bcdedit”并按回车键,以查看当前的启动...

  • c# KeyValuePair的用法

    在C#中,KeyValuePair 是一种表示键值对的结构体。它定义了两个属性,Key和Value,分别表示键和值。
    KeyValuePair可以用于以下几种情况: 在循环中遍历字典...

  • Oracle四舍五入,向上取整,向下取整

    Oracle中的四舍五入、向上取整和向下取整可以使用不同的函数来实现。以下是几种常用的函数: 四舍五入:
    使用ROUND函数来实现四舍五入。ROUND函数接收两个参...